'''Booster packs''' are typically packs of 10 cards from an [[List of Pokémon Trading Card Game expansions|expansion]] in the [[Pokémon Trading Card Game]]. Boosters offer the chance to acquire cards to strengthen [[Theme Deck]]s, create {{DL|Deck|Constructed Deck|new decks}}, or customize old ones. Boosters contain cards that vary by [[Rarity]] level, representing how likely or unlikely the card may be found in a booster. These Rarity levels include Common ({{rar|Common}}), Uncommon ({{rar|Uncommon}}), and Rare ({{rar|Rare}}) cards, as well as occasionally ''"super rare"'' cards such as {{TCG|Pokémon-ex}}, {{TCG|Pokémon Star}}, {{TCG|Shining Pokémon}}, {{TCG|Pokémon LV.X}} or {{TCG|Pokémon LEGEND}}.

Booster packs have contained varying amounts of cards over the years. From the first {{TCG|Base Set}} through to {{TCG|Neo Destiny}} expansion, boosters contained 11 cards. Beginning with the {{TCG|Expedition Base Set|e-Card Series}} and continuing through the entirety of the {{TCG|EX Power Keepers|EX Series}}, boosters had only 9 cards. Since the release of the first {{TCG|Diamond & Pearl}} [[List of Pokémon Trading Card Game expansions|expansion]], booster size was increased to 10.
